The size of Redbank Plains is approximately 18.0 square kilometres. There are 31 parks, covering nearly 9.0% of the total area. The population of Redbank Plains in 2016 was 19299 people. By 2021 the population was 24349 showing a population growth of 26.2%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Redbank Plains is 0-9 years. Households in Redbank Plains are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1400 - $1799 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Redbank Plains work in a community and personal service occupation.In 2021, 39.70% of the homes in Redbank Plains were owner-occupied compared with 42.20% in 2016.
